The HR Generalist reports to the HR Manager and works closely with the operations and senior leadership team. The HR Generalist role is based out of our Toronto studio, with some work-from-home flexibility, while providing remote support to employees in L.A., D.C., Barcelona, and the UK. Acting as the first point of contact, the HR Generalist provides staff with prompt and courteous responses to their questions related to HR procedures, policies, and programs. Key responsibilities also include supporting full cycle recruitment, onboarding related activities, supporting health & safety initiatives, managing the HRIS and employee time off requests, group benefit enrollments, and general administrative and coordination support for the HR department.

Roles & Responsibilities 

Lead full cycle recruitment for teams worldwide, including creating job requisitions, resume screening, coordinating and conducting interviews, reference checks, and preparing offer lettersManage the new hire onboarding process, including coordinating and facilitating meetings, to ensure seamless onboarding experiences for new team membersAssist the HR Manager with administrative tasks related to offboarding employees Assist staff with their questions related to HR policies, programs, and procedures Research and apply for government grantsDraft employment confirmation letters for employees Manage employee time off request process with adherence to company policyParticipate in the Joint Health and Safety Committee (JHSC) as a member, including attending meetings, acting as the secretary, and supporting compliance auditsAssist the HR Manager with health & safety compliance initiatives globally Provide administrative support and coordination of staff training for regional complianceSupport HRIS (ADP) maintenance and process improvements through the accurate entry of electronic employee files, manage access permissions, perform data audits, and assist with researching and testing process changes.Provide administrative support and coordination of employee performance reviews, promotions, and compensation reviews. Provide general administration and coordination for the HR departmentSupport and lead some HR projects and initiativesOccasionally develop HR communications as neededContribute, with a continuous improvement mindset, to the implementation of a best-in-class talent functionContinue to promote the firm’s positive workplace culture of feedback, open communication, and firm values.

Key Skills and Requirements

Minimum of five years of relevant HR experience, including three years of full cycle recruitment experience in a fast-paced environment is requiredPrevious experience in advertising, media, entertainment, or other creative industries and/or within a professional services firm an assetPost-secondary degree and/or diploma, with a focus in HR or related fieldCHRP designation, completed or in progress is an assetAdvanced skills in MS Outlook, Word, and intermediate skills in ExcelHRIS experience is required; ADP preferredExcellent verbal and written communication skills Extremely organized and detail orientatedAble to proactively problem solve, exercise good judgment, and make decisionsProven ability to take initiative, manage competing initiatives, and meet deadlines without compromising quality of workProven ability to maintain strict confidentiality with sensitive informationAble to work effectively both independently as well as part of a team Dynamic personality that can drive outcomes and build relationship in a collaborative environment
